Top Folding Exercise Bikes for Limited Space
This buying guide explores the best folding exercise bikes available for those with limited space. With the rise of home fitness, having a compact and versatile exercise bike can make a significant difference in your workout routine, especially when space is at a premium. Folding exercise bikes offer convenience and practicality, allowing you to store them away easily when not in use, making them ideal for small apartments or homes.
This guide is designed for individuals looking to enhance their fitness without compromising on space. Whether you're a beginner or someone looking to get back into shape, you'll learn about essential features to consider, such as resistance levels, weight capacity, and ease of folding. Prices for folding exercise bikes typically range from budget-friendly options to more advanced models, so you can find something that fits your needs and budget.
Research Your Options
Take the time to compare different folding exercise bikes to find the best fit for your needs. Look for customer reviews and expert recommendations that highlight the pros and cons of various models.

Measure Your Space
Before purchasing, measure the area where you plan to use and store the bike. Ensure that it fits comfortably in your designated space, both when in use and when folded away.
Check Folding Mechanism
Look for bikes with a simple and efficient folding mechanism. This will save you time and effort when setting up or packing away your bike after workouts.
Prioritise Stability and Safety
Ensure that the bike has a sturdy frame and a secure locking mechanism when folded. This is vital for both safety and performance during your workouts.
Consider Your Budget
Set a budget before you start shopping. Folding exercise bikes can vary widely in price, so knowing your budget will help you narrow down your options effectively.
Evaluate Delivery Options
Check the delivery options available for your chosen bike. Some retailers may offer free delivery or assembly services, which can be an added convenience for your purchase.
